Hi Everyone, I signed up just to ask if anyone can confirm if the Sony 77-inch XR A80J has a gigabit ethernet port, or a 100mbit? None of the specifications seem to list this which makes me suss, and lead to believe it is still only 100mbit.

I have a Sony KD-75X8500E and it only has 100mbit. Playing 4k sucks, because it keeps stopping to buffer because the network is too slow. The only way around it is to use wifi which connects slowly and causes other issues.
 
Hi Everyone, I signed up just to ask if anyone can confirm if the Sony 77-inch XR A80J has a gigabit ethernet port, or a 100mbit? None of the specifications seem to list this which makes me suss, and lead to believe it is still only 100mbit.

I have a Sony KD-75X8500E and it only has 100mbit. Playing 4k sucks, because it keeps stopping to buffer because the network is too slow. The only way around it is to use wifi which connects slowly and causes other issues.
Do any of your other devices buffer when watching 4k?
 
i dont believe it has a gigabit port. People in the US are buying USB 3.0 to ethernet adaptors to overcome the limitation of the built in port. I also got one as my cable was about 5cm too short to reach the built in port so had no choice.

I can confirm it is only a 100 m/bit ethernet port on the A80J 55", got mine wired in and the hub indicates its only 100 m/bit. I read somewhere that this is sufficient for 4K HDR content as it reaches about 80 m/bit max
 
So do you know if it has a gigabit port or not?

That's what I want to know. Not if you buffer or not in netflix thanks.
It's definitely not gigabit. 100 m/b is way more than you would need to stream 4k HDR so whatever your problem is, it's not that. Have you checked your actual speed to the TV?
